Address

DRTwZcUahd8ZgaHKhQkdJ721oAsTaaEH2CCopy

Total Received

634.09627172 DGB

Total Sent

634.09627172 DGB

№ Transactions

2

Final Balance

0 DGB

Transactions
Filter